What is 10+ 100+199 +900

Mathematics
2 answers:
Bogdan [553]3 years ago
5 0

Answer: 1,209

Step-by-step explanation:

10 + 100 = 110

110 + 199 = 309

309 + 900 = 1,209

I am so stuck! :( Pls help me!!! I don't get the problem and I don't know how to solve it
Lelu [443]

Answer:

\frac{n^{2}}{2a}

Step-by-step explanation:

  • Just split it up first \frac{9an^{3}}{18a^{2}n}=\frac{9}{18}\times \frac{a}{a^2} \times\frac{n^3}{n}
  • Then 9 divided by 18 can be simplified into the fraction 1/2
  • What can go into a and a^2 ? a itself right, so if you divide a by a you get 1, if you divide a^2 by a you get a
  • Same as the a fraction, if you divide n^3 by n you get n^2
  • \frac{9an^{3}}{18a^{2}n}=\frac{9}{18}\times \frac{a}{a^2} \times\frac{n^3}{n}=\frac{1}{2}\times \frac{1}{a} \times\frac{n^2}{1}=\frac{n^{2}}{2a}
